The coming year: after 40 years, the timeless song by Lucio Dalla becomes a video full of hope

The date for its launch could not fail to be that close to the end of the year. After the celebration of the 40th anniversary of 'Lucio Dalla', the homonymous album by the Bolognese singer-songwriter, the video of the song 'L'Anno Che Verrà' is now released, which excites us every New Year and gives us hope.

A year of celebrations that ends in the best way after the release of 'Lucio Dalla - Legacy Edition' with 3 songs in the unreleased version: 'Angeli' in the studio version, 'Stella di mare' in English and the song 'Ma come fare i marinai' feat. Francesco De Gregori in the unedited version recorded in the studio.

But 'The year to come' remains timeless and this New Year as well as singing out loud there 1979 song you will also be able to see the clip that introduces us to another time, the one in which letters were written with the typewriter.

The new video directed by Marco Pellegrino it tells precisely the minutes before midnight of the new year.

WATCH THE VIDEO:

“It's December 31st. There are a few minutes left for the start of the new year. The time for a song, the time for a man to write a long letter to himself. The time of a lifetime ”, explains Pellegrino in a press release.

The song arranged by Giampiero Reverberi, with Ron playing the piano, begins with "Dear friend, I am writing to you, so I get a little distracted" and Dalla himself explained several times in his long and intense career that "It is an important song because it imagines a situation of distance between me and a friend and to whom I make a detailed report of how we are living today: in the first part there is a mechanism of the game that allows me to exaggerate ".

Without forgetting the historical references: "We go out a little in the evening including when it's a holiday and there are those who have put sandbags near the window", thus recalling the terrorist attacks, Dalla sends a message of hope: "It will be three times Christmas and party all day, every Christ will come down from the cross even the birds will return (...) and without great disturbances someone will disappear, perhaps the too clever and idiots of all ages will be ”. And it will be the Bolognese singer-songwriter himself to say that he made 'a song that is not pessimistic, but without miracles'.

The clip is already online, but will be screened on 10 January in the cinema hall of the Lucio Dalla Foundation in Bologna. What about a timeless masterpiece.
